Community Open House on Maggie L. Walker Public Art and Plaza Design and a counter rally

According to Newton “to every force there is a reaction force that is equal in size, but opposite in direction”, it remains to be seen whether these two forces are equal in size.

From Eventbrite:

Please join Public Artist Toby Mendez, the design team and Richmond’s Public Art Commission for an open house to share ideas and give feedback on initial concepts for artwork and plaza design for the Public Art to honor Maggie L. Walker.
Please stop by anytime between 10am – 12pm to have a chance to see the initial concepts and meet the artist and design team.

WHEN
Saturday, February 20, 2016 from 10:00 AM to 12:00 PM (EST)
WHERE
Richmond Public Library – Main Branch auditorium basement level – 101 East Franklin Street Richmond, VA 23219

Then there is the other side of the coin, which will be holding a rally against the effort that will begin at noon.
